The relation between modes of lithologic association and interlayer-gliding structures in coal mine 被引量:6

As a case study of the Panji No.1 Coal Mine in Anhui Province, based on the site measured and statistical data, summarized the lithologic associations, characteristics and distribution laws of interlayer-gliding structures and tectonic coal in the No.11-2 coal seams. The results show that 9 modes of lithologic association can form interlayer-gliding structures. It is more easy for rock slip to occur when the lithologic associations are main roof + coal seam + immediate floor type, compound roof+immediate roof + coal seam + immediate floor type and immediate roof + coal seam + immediate floor type. Lithologic associations of roof and floor are the precondition to the formation of interlayer-gliding structures.
